Etymology of MOST FANTASIZED

The word "fantasize" derives from the word "fantasy", which has a Latin origin. "Fantasia" in Latin means "imagination" or "imagination faculty". Over time, it evolved into "fantasie" in Old French and later transformed into "fantasy" in Middle English. The word "most" is an intensifying adverb used to indicate a high degree or extent. Therefore, the term "most fantasized" combines the adverb "most" with the verb "fantasize" to describe something that is highly imagined or daydreamed about.
